How can mothers increase the amount of breast milk they produce?
You can increase milk production by doing the following things. The length of time it takes to increase their milk supply is determined by how low it was, to begin with, it and what’s causing their low milk production. Many of these methods should start working within several days if they work for you.
Breastfeed your child more frequently.
Breastfeed frequently and let their baby decide whenever it’s time to stop. It helps in increasing the milk produced by your breasts. Breastfeeding their newborn 8 to 12 times per day can aid in milk production establishment and maintenance. Pump in the intervals between feedings
Pumping in between feeding times can also assist you in producing more milk. Breastfeed both sides of the baby
At each feeding, have your baby feed from both breasts. Breastfeeding both breasts can significantly boost milk production by stimulating them. It has also been discovered that pumping milk from both breasts simultaneously increases milk production and results in higher fat content inside the milk.
Cookies for lactation
Lactation cookies are available in stores and on Amazon, and you can make your own. While there is no research on lactation cookies, a few of the ingredients have been linked to increased breast milk production. Galactagogues are found in these foods as well as herbs, and they may help with lactation a reliable source-
- whole oats
- wheat germ
- flaxseed meal

As per the Canadian Breastfeeding Foundation, some other foods and herbs can help increase breast milk production. Fenugreek, for example, has been shown to work for as few as seven days. The following foods and herbs are among them:
- garlic
- ginger
- fenugreek
- fennel
Anxiety, stress, and sometimes even embarrassment can end up causing users to produce less milk by interfering with the let-down reflex.
